Output d2443c355968c2d0ed83610097ba73ed6d68921e864cb6c176faf84802a7b7e4:1

value
40778180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 801fe1a4f4f78599ea021848602fc93032882247 OP_EQUAL
address
3DNUcFvkAQ48du9yUFnWYtKDFkvJr2i9S5
transaction
d2443c355968c2d0ed83610097ba73ed6d68921e864cb6c176faf84802a7b7e4
spent
true